In addition to Angkor Wat, the largest religious structure in the world, and the famous Ta Prohm Temple, with its 300-year-old tree-topped structure and famous for its Tomb Raider temple, there is the magnificent Bayon Temple, famous for its smiling face, located in the center of the ancient city of Angkor Thom during the golden age of the Khmer Empire in the late 12th and early 13th centuries, during the reign of King Jayavarman VII.

You can spend more time learning about stone and wood carving, silk weaving, and other paintings. Especially learning about Theravada Buddhism, the real life of the Buddha before his enlightenment, and the current disciples, called monks, who live in monasteries. And you will try street food and the food that local Khmer people like to eat the most, especially fried insects, and so on.

The Khmer Empire was a Hindu-Buddhist empire in Southeast Asia, centered around hydraulic cities in what is now northern Cambodia. Known as Kambuja (Old Khmer) by its inhabitants, it grew out of the former civilization of Chenla and lasted from 802 to 1431.

Historians call this period of Cambodian history the Angkor period, after the empire's most well-known capital, Angkor.

The Khmer Empire ruled or vassalized most of mainland Southeast Asia. Rich, powerful, and glorious during that time.

As you may know, the government recently completed a new road through our village. This project has brought many positive changes for local families—safer travel during the rainy season, easier access to markets and health services, and shorter transport times for students attending public school in nearby areas. The road has already helped the community feel more connected and opened new opportunities for work and trade that were previously difficult to reach.

As part of the planned construction, two of our JB School classrooms had to be removed to make way for the road. While we welcome the wider benefits this infrastructure provides, the loss of these classrooms has placed significant strain on our teaching space. With more than 400 children attending JB School every day for their English and computer lessons, rebuilding these classrooms is essential if we are to continue providing a safe, accessible, and effective learning environment.

For many of our students, this free education is their only opportunity to learn English and computer skills. These are the skills that open doors: to jobs in tourism, to higher education, and to opportunities that can lift entire families out of poverty. JB School gives young people a sense of possibility and confidence in their future, and your support plays an important role in sustaining that hope.

Alongside the rebuilding effort, we continue to operate on a monthly budget of USD 1,500, which covers teacher salaries, utilities, and essential learning materials. The asphalt road has been built, is wide and beautiful, and doesn't flood like before, and it's not dusty anymore.

And the JB School grounds are also clean. It really helps the environment and the health of the local people.

Especially helping to promote the natural tourism sector of the Kampong Phluk community (stilt house village, Tonle Sap Lake).

All the people in the region are very happy for the state's asphalt road achievements.

All of us, the people of Prasat Bakong District, would like to express our deepest gratitude to the Royal Government of Cambodia for providing us with a 16-kilometre-long, comfortable road this year as a gift for the year 2025.
